Groove Picks Up Conley, Waives Anderson
November 22, 2002 - NBA G League (G League)
Greenville Groove News Release
GREENVILLE, S.C. (November 22, 2002) - The Greenville Groove has added forward Robert Conley to its roster, according to an announcement today by National Basketball Development League Executive Director Karl Hicks and Groove Head Coach Tree Rollins. Greenville also waived forward Christian Anderson.
A Division II All-America selection out of Clayton (Ga.) State University, Conley has played internationally and was a member of the Memphis Grizzlies summer league roster this year. As a senior at Clayton State, he averaged 24.6 points and 6.7 rebounds per game. Conley, who prepped at Columbia High School in Atlanta, shot 55-percent from the floor as a senior at Clayton State.
Anderson averaged 3.0 points and 1.3 rebounds in three games for the Groove this season.
Conley will join the Groove for tonight's game in Fayetteville and will wear jersey number 3.
